Job Description
 
Performs managerial and professional work; plans, directs, and oversees the operations of the Communications team consisting of the following specialized areas: multimedia (video, photography, editing, and AV set up), graphic design, interactive programs (web and social media), and special events. Responsibilities include: performing professional public relations on behalf of the Office of the Mayor and the City's operating departments; the development, implementation, and evaluation of strategic communication plans to market and promote the Mayor's key priorities and the City initiatives, programs, and services; managerial functions of overseeing a team of graphic designers, multimedia producers, event managers, and digital communicators who manage the City's website and social media policy/accounts; and managing those respective budgets. Duties require: the exercise of considerable initiative and independent judgment in strategic communications; the planning and marketing of events; reviewing contracts; budgeting; managing assigned personnel; the procurement of resources; handling special projects; establishing media relations; public speaking; developing writing/talking points, scripts, and promotional materials; conducting editorial review and quality control; and dealing with elected/appointed officials, promoters, clients, other City departments/internal staff, and the local community.

Minimum Qualifications:

Bachelor's Degree in Marketing, Public Relations, Mass Communications, Journalism, Public Administration, or a related field plus a minimum of four (4) years experience performing professional and supervisory work in the areas of event planning/management, multimedia (video, photography and editing); interactive programs (Web, social media and content management systems); graphic design; marketing and promotions; program budgeting; or an equivalent combination of education, training, and experience.

EXAMPLES OF WORK PERFORMED:

Note: The listed duties are only illustrative and are not intended to describe every function that may be performed by this job class. The omission of specific statements does not preclude management from assigning specific duties not listed if such duties are a logical assignment to the position.

Oversees the overall operations of the Communications Team including interactive programs, multimedia, graphics, and special events.

Develops short-term and long-term goals and objectives.

Establishes, implements, and manages the team's core services (budget, marketing plan, and staffing plans) in accordance with the City's strategic mission and vision.

Develops and implements internal/external policies and procedures.

Develops website and social media strategies.

Develops multimedia assets
